Griffith Review 53: Our Sporting Life


Overview

From Olympia to Alice Springs, from the opening bounce to the close of play, from sports fields to board rooms, from cutting-edge strategy to kitchen-table yarns, Our Sporting Life includes outstanding sports writers and those who have been involved in the many sports-related industries. It's a fascinating examination of what sport means beyond the thrill of the competition and the desire to win.

Author Information

Julianne Schultz AM FAHA is the founding editor of Griffith Review, the award-winning literary and public affairs quarterly journal.
